What is Digital Presence

In layman's terms, digital presence is the overall existence of your brand online. It's your website, your social media profiles, your blog posts, and every single digital footprint you leave behind. It's the digital face of your business, and it's what your customers see when they look for you.

Choose Social Media Platforms That Suit You

Social Media is the most authoritative platform in the world. However, not all social media platforms may be suitable for every brand. Thus, to effectively reach and engage with your community, using channels that are relevant to your target audience and brand messaging is critical.
